They want skilled work. An MBA says you don’t want to do the actual work, just manage everything - of which there are far fewer jobs. If you don’t already have extensive management experience an MBA isn’t a plus. If you do, you’ll be looking for more rare openings for higher level positions.

It’s similar to having a PhD, for most good jobs you’re overqualified and it is a negative. You need to fill a very specific role.

A STEM masters degree is a sweet spot.
